The following is a patch to centralize the test for an active-enabled
breakpoint. This patch is in response to Daniel J's comments to split
up the pending-breakpoint support patch. With pending breakpoint
support, the test will be modified to include a check for a pending
breakpoint. This will simplify reviewing the last of the patches
required for pending-breakpoint support.

2003-12-10 Jeff Johnston <jjohnstn@redhat.com>
* breakpoint.c (breakpoint_enabled): New function to test whether
breakpoint is
active and enabled.
( insert_bp_location, insert_breakpoints): Call new function to test
for enabled breakpoint.
(remove_breakpoint, breakpoint_here_p): Ditto.
(breakpoint_thread_match): Ditto.
(bpstat_should_step, bpstat_have_active_hw_watchpoints): Ditto.
(disable_breakpoints_in_shlibs): Ditto.
(hw_watchpoint_used_count): Ditto.
(disable_watchpoints_before_interactive_call_start): Ditto.
(breakpoint_re_set_one): Ditto.
(bpstat_stop_status): Use new function and simplify test.
